MY LITTLE - BIG MUSEUM 
A cretive journey intro imagination
and stories

Workshop for children aged 9–12 (in Greek)

In this year’s workshop, Psaroloco merges the world of literature with the magic of the silver screen. Inspired by Sophia Dartzali’s book "Where Did Everyone Go? " and the short film

"I Found a Box" (dir. Éric Montchaud), we explore the power of imagination in the face of stillness.

DUBBING WORKSHOP
The Magic World Behind the Voice

Workshop for teenagers aged 12-16 (in Greek) 

Psaroloco invites teenagers to discover one of the most fascinating and invisible sides of the film industry. Under the guidance of Akindynos Gkikas and his years of experience, participants are introduced to the art of dubbing—where acting meets the ultimate synchronization of image and sound.
